Istanbul to Cairo

1h 59m The flight from İstanbul Airport (IST) to Cairo International Airport (CAI) covers 1,264 km (786 miles) and takes approximately 1h 59m gate to gate for a typical jet.

The route heads south on an initial great-circle bearing of 168°, passing near 35.7° N, 30.2° E at its midpoint.

Flight time at different cruise speeds

Aircraft type, winds and routing all move the real number. This is the same distance flown at different speeds, plus the 25-minute ground and climb allowance.

Typical ofCruise speedAirborneGate to gate
Turboprop / regional550 km/h2h 18m2h 43m
Narrowbody jet (A320, 737)780 km/h1h 37m2h 02m
Widebody jet (777, 787, A350)900 km/h1h 24m1h 49m
Private jet (Gulfstream)850 km/h1h 29m1h 54m

Headwinds on an eastbound long-haul routinely add 30–60 minutes; the same route westbound can be quicker. Airlines publish schedules with padding built in.

How far is Istanbul from Cairo?

1,264 kilometres in a straight line over the earth's surface — 786 miles or 683 nautical miles. Actual flown distance is usually 2–5% longer because aircraft follow airways, avoid weather and route around restricted airspace.
